The media centre for the 46th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) Summit, which will be held in the Kingdom of Bahrain tomorrow, Wednesday, December 4, was inaugurated.
The event was attended by Jasim Mohammed Albudaiwi, Secretary General of the GCC; Nabil bin Yaqoub Al Hamer, Adviser to His Majesty the King for Media Affairs; and Dr. Ramzan bin Abdulla Al Noaimi, Minister of Information and Chairman of the Board of Directors of the National Communication Centre (NCC).
Dr. Al Noaimi expressed Bahrain’s pride in hosting the 46th GCC Summit, emphasising the Kingdom’s commitment to advancing joint Gulf initiatives under the leadership of His Majesty King Hamad bin Isa Al Khalifa and the continued support of His Royal Highness Prince Salman bin Hamad Al Khalifa, the Crown Prince and Prime Minister. He noted that these efforts aim to enhance the GCC’s cooperation, promoting greater integration and prosperity, grounded in a firm belief in unity of purpose and shared objectives.
The information Minister noted that the summit is a major regional event showcasing Gulf cohesion and solidarity. He added that its timing calls for enhanced media efforts to convey its important messages and strategic significance. The Ministry of Information, the NCC, and all relevant authorities in the Kingdom are fully committed to supporting local, regional, and international media, enabling them to carry out their professional work and effectively highlight the importance of this key milestone in the GCC’s ongoing journey.
GCC Secretary General Albudaiwi, Advisor Al Hamer and Dr. Al Noaimi toured the media centre and accompanying exhibition, reviewing the technical and organisational preparations designed to provide comprehensive media services for the summit.
They commended the efforts invested in preparing the media centre according to the highest professional standards and commended the continuous work of media personnel in providing full coverage that reflects the importance of the summit and its role in advancing joint Gulf initiatives.
